Read a letter of the English boy Phil. Choose the right answers to the questions.
I am especially proud of a national hero of Britain, Robert Scott, who made risky journeys to Antarctica at the beginning of the 20th century. His dream was to be the first person at the South Pole and he reached it in 1910, but when he arrived there, he found a tent and the Norwegian flag. It meant that he lost the race against Roald Amundsen, a Norwegian explorer. They were competing on the way to the Pole. Amundsen and Scott were very different from each other and made very different plans. Amundsen took sleds and dog teams as the great Arctic explorers did. Scott took ponies and a few dogs. He also had bad luck with the weather - days of blizzards and strong winds. Robert kept a diary in which he described his hard journey. The most tragic thing happened on the return journey to his ship - he died of extreme cold and hunger.
But the name of Robert Scott as a great explorer of Antarctica lives on in my heart. I can’t help admiring his courage and will power.
